As amazing as Git is for handling your source code, you can certain git (lol) yourself into trouble. What if you make a change to a file and you want to get rid of the change? What if you just want to get rid of part of the change? What if you’ve already committed it? What if the commit was good but the commit message was bad? Those are just the first few that we cover in this video.
